summ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Andrew Davis <afd@ti.com>2026-03-02 22:56:14 +0300
committerMathieu Poirier <mathieu.poirier@linaro.org>2026-03-06 18:34:51 +0300
commit3bd256e8cd2abec45811d8bcb6f7240f0b122c6a (patch)
tree5c43f10191a4531b91641399741eeb2a3b19e38a
parent5b1f4b5c72cc40e676293b8609cacef7e1545beb (diff)
downloadlinux-3bd256e8cd2abec45811d8bcb6f7240f0b122c6a.tar.xz
remoteproc: da8xx: Use dev_err_probe()
Simplify the probe() code by using dev_err_probe(). Signed-off-by: Andrew Davis <afd@ti.com> Link: https://lore.kernel.org/r/20260302195616.312378-1-afd@ti.com Signed-off-by: Mathieu Poirier <mathieu.poirier@linaro.org>
-rw-r--r--drivers/remoteproc/da8xx_remoteproc.c12
1 files changed, 4 insertions, 8 deletions
diff --git a/drivers/remoteproc/da8xx_remoteproc.c b/drivers/remoteproc/da8xx_remoteproc.c
index e418a2bf5d2e..41744f3f0252 100644
--- a/drivers/remoteproc/da8xx_remoteproc.c
+++ b/drivers/remoteproc/da8xx_remoteproc.c
@@ -306,10 +306,8 @@ static int da8xx_rproc_probe(struct platform_device *pdev)
ret = devm_request_threaded_irq(dev, irq, da8xx_rproc_callback,
handle_event, 0, "da8xx-remoteproc",
rproc);
- if (ret) {
- dev_err(dev, "devm_request_threaded_irq error: %d\n", ret);
- return ret;
- }
+ if (ret)
+ return dev_err_probe(dev, ret, "devm_request_threaded_irq error\n");
/*
* rproc_add() can end up enabling the DSP's clk with the DSP
@@ -327,10 +325,8 @@ static int da8xx_rproc_probe(struct platform_device *pdev)
drproc->irq = irq;
ret = devm_rproc_add(dev, rproc);
- if (ret) {
- dev_err(dev, "rproc_add failed: %d\n", ret);
- return ret;
- }
+ if (ret)
+ return dev_err_probe(dev, ret, "rproc_add failed\n");
return 0;
}